Zucchini Noodle Stir-Fry with Shrimp

  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ings

Description

Zucchini Noodle Stir-Fry with Shrimp is a fresh and healthy dish that swaps traditional noodles for spiralized zucchini, making it a low-carb, gluten-free meal. Packed with shrimp, bell peppers, and a savory sauce, this quick 25-minute stir-fry is perfect for a light yet satisfying dinner.


Ingredients

  • 1 lb (450g) large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 3 medium zucchini, spiralized
  • 1 red bell pepper, thinly sliced
  • 1 yellow bell pepper, thinly sliced
  • 1 small red onion, thinly sliced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ce (or tamari for gluten-free)
  • 1 tbsp hoisin sauce
  • 1 tbsp sesame oil
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p grated fresh ginger
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Sesame seeds and chopped green onions for garnish

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Shrimp: Season shrimp with salt and pepper.
  2. Cook the Shrimp: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Sauté shrimp for 2-3 minutes per side until pink. Remove and set aside.
  3. Sauté Vegetables: In the same skillet, heat sesame oil. Cook bell peppers, onion, and garlic for 3-4 minutes until softened.
  4. Add Zoodles: Add zucchini noodles, cooking for 2-3 minutes until just tender.
  5. Combine & Toss: Return shrimp to the skillet, add soy sauce, hoisin sauce, and ginger. Toss well and cook for another 1-2 minutes.
  6. Serve: Garnish with sesame seeds and green onions. Serve immediately.

Notes

  • Protein Swap: Replace shrimp with chicken, tofu, or beef.
  • Extra Veggies: Add mushrooms, snap peas, or carrots.
  • Spice It Up: Mix in red pepper flakes or sriracha for heat.
  • Storage: Keep leftovers in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
